  • 5/5 Sarah I. 5 years ago on Google
    We were looking for somewhere that would allow us to have an early check in as we were going to a wedding at 2pm and most places don't allow check in before this time. Stephen was more than happy to accommodate us for a 12pm check in. However we changed our plans & booked an extra night, and we were so pleased we did! We had room 3 on the top floor, a few stairs to negotiate!, but it was worth it as it had a balcony on which we were able to have our breakfast. The breakfast itself was just amazing, so beautifully presented, a fabulous start to the day. The room was very nice, and this is not a criticism, it is a loft room so it has sloped ceilings so you have to be careful if you are tall. We both liked having our breakfast in our room it made a big difference not to have to get ready to go to a dinning room. Check out was at 11am which was also a plus. Stephen & his partner were very attentive and made us feel most welcome. Loved the fact that when we left they gave us bottles of water for our journey home. Would thoroughly recommend Cliftonville Townhouse.
